OFF-time modulator - details Referring to Figure 7, once the power switch ON-time is ended (Q signal goes low) the internal switch SW5 is open and the constant current generator IR starts to charge linearly the capacitor CR. The resulting voltage VRAMP is compared with the voltage VTH_RAMP, which is generated by the “Constant FSW“ circuitry based on the Q signal duration (TON). As soon as the ramp voltage VRAMP reaches the VTH_RAMP voltage, the flip-flop is set and the external power switch is turned on (Q signal goes high). In other words, the power switch off-time (TOFF) is modulated based on the on-time information (TON) to keep cycle-by-cycle constant the resulting switching frequency (FSW=1/TSW_TARGET): TOFF = TSW_TARGET - TON.
